Pride of Madeira at Pico de Arieiro - stock photo
(Echium candicans or Echium fastuosum) is a rapidly growing tropical or tender perennial/biennial shrub from the borage family (boraginaceae) that grows up to eight feet in full sun. Seen on the edge of Curral das Freiras valley along hiking trail at Pico de Arieiro. Pico do Arieiro, Madeira island's third highest peak. The footpath northwards towards Pico Ruivo is an important tourist attraction, with a daily average of 1000 tourists trekking on it.
